Diagnosis

Your doctor will perform physical examinations to determine mesothelioma. They will ask about any symptoms and your previous exposure to asbestos. Before examining for cancer, they will first determine if you have a common illness such as pneumonia.

If they suspect that you have mesothelioma the doctor avon mesothelioma Lawsuit will recommend imaging scans of your abdomen and chest. These tests utilize x-rays CT scans and MRIs to take images of the internal organs of your body. These scans can reveal the accumulation of fluid in your abdomen or lungs (ascites). They can also be used to find mesothelioma tumours and determine whether they are growing.

These tests can reveal a number of possible indicators of rockville centre mesothelioma lawsuit, but the only method to establish an accurate diagnosis is by collecting tissue samples and analyzing them under microscope. This is known as biopsy. A pathologist is a specialist in interpreting lab tests and amigo1.co.kr evaluating tissues, cells and organs to diagnose the disease.

It can develop in the heart. When it grows in the heart, it is called mesothelioma pericardial. These tumors can be harder to detect and are less frequent than pleural mesothelioma.

Doctors may employ a needle to remove a small amount fluid from the location where the fluid has accumulated. They will then examine the fluid for mesothelioma cells and look at a piece of your lung for mesothelioma tumors.

They might also conduct blood chemistry tests to determine how well your kidneys, liver and thyroid are functioning. One specific test they might run is a lactate dehydrogenase (LDH) test. LDH levels that are higher than normal can be a sign of cell damage, and could indicate mesothelioma.

Clinical trials

Scientists are constantly searching for ways to improve the way they detect mesothelioma and then treat it. Clinical trials give patients the chance to test new treatments that are more effective than the ones doctors currently employ. The goal is to increase the odds of survival and to find cures.

Doctors also research new treatment techniques, including surgery, chemotherapy and radiation therapy, as well as immunotherapy. Combining these methods offers patients more options. Many mesothelioma patients participate in clinical trials if standard treatments do not work.

Clinical trials can take months, weeks or even years. During the trial, participants are given an experimental medication or therapy and supervised closely by experts. Before the FDA will approve a medication for use in general it must go through a number of phases of clinical trials.

Some of these studies test new types of chemotherapy. The most recent treatments are targeted to specific genetic pathways that are present in cancer cells. The results of these studies could aid scientists identify better treatment options for mesothelioma and other kinds of cancers.

Researchers are also researching ways to prevent mesothelioma. In studies involving populations at high risk researchers are examining whether lifestyle changes and specific medicines can decrease the risk of developing cancer. Some of these trials examine ways to detect mesothelioma earlier in patients.

Doctors are also studying surgery and other surgical procedures for kennesaw mesothelioma attorney. There are several surgical procedures that are available to treat mesothelioma. These include extrapleural pneumonectomy (which removes the affected lung, pleura and chest wall) pleurectomy that includes diaphragmatic decortication (which eliminates lungs and a part of the chest wall) and trimodality therapy which includes radiation, surgery, and chemotherapy.

Certain doctors are also studying the effectiveness of immunotherapy for mesothelioma. This kind of treatment involves injecting mesothelioma patients with an immune system-boosting drug that targets cancerous cells. Immunotherapy is a method of treatment that can be utilized for advanced pleural tumors and to increase the odds of survival. It is also being studied as an option for treatment first-line in the peritoneal cancer. A randomized controlled study of the mesothelioma immune therapy drug tremelimumab is in the beginning. Participants are compared to those who received placebo. The tremelimumab-treated group has an overall survival rate that is higher than those who received a placebo.
